VoicePen AI vs Splice
Side-by-side comparison of features, pricing, and ratings
At a glance
| Dimension | VoicePen AI | Splice |
|---|---|---|
| Pricing | Free tier with limited characters; paid plans start at $20/mo | Free trial; $4.99/mo for 200 credits; $12.99/mo for Splice INSTRUMENT |
| Primary Use | Convert audio/video to blog posts | Royalty-free samples and rent-to-own plugins |
| Key Feature | Transcription in 96 languages, GPT-4 blog generation | 2M+ samples, rent-to-own Serum 2, credit rollover |
| Integrations | WordPress, Medium, Ghost, LinkedIn, Twitter, Facebook, Webflow | Ableton Live, Studio One Pro, Pro Tools, Studio Pro, MCP |
| Target User | Content creators, podcasters, marketers | Music producers, beatmakers, hobbyists |
| Best For | Repurposing spoken content into articles | Building royalty-free sample libraries and affordable plugin ownership |
Choose VoicePen AI if you repurpose audio/video into blog posts; choose Splice if you produce music and need samples or want to rent-to-own plugins. They solve entirely different problems, so your decision hinges on whether you're a content writer or a music producer.

Splice
117 mentions across 7 sources · 50% positive — mixed
Hacker News, YouTube, Product Hunt, App Store, Stack Overflow, GitHub, Lemmy
What users praise
- • Massive library of royalty-free samples across 90+ genres, including hip-hop and EDM.
- • Rent-to-own plugins let you own Serum 2, RC-20, and more with no interest.
- • Credits roll over up to 200, so you never lose unused downloads.
- • Works with all major DAWs and offers in-DAW integration via the Splice Sounds Plugin.
What frustrates them
- • Frequent crashes, especially on heavy projects, disrupt workflow.
- • Prices have risen steadily, now $9.99/week — a huge annual cost.
- • Many sounds are overused, costing originality.
- • Copyright concerns on streaming due to popular loops being too recognizable.

Frequently Asked Questions
VoicePen AI vs Splice: which should you choose?
Choose VoicePen AI if you repurpose audio/video into blog posts; choose Splice if you produce music and need samples or want to rent-to-own plugins. They solve entirely different problems, so your decision hinges on whether you're a content writer or a music producer.
Can VoicePen AI generate blogs in languages other than English?
According to the data, transcription supports 96 languages, but blog post generation is only in English.
Does Splice offer a free plan?
Yes, Splice provides a free trial with limited credits to explore the sample library.
Can I publish directly to social media with VoicePen AI?
VoicePen AI integrates with LinkedIn, Twitter, and Facebook for publishing.
What DAWs does Splice integrate with?
Ableton Live 12.3+, Studio One Pro 7, Pro Tools 2025.6+, Studio Pro 8+, and Splice Sounds Plugin (beta).
Does VoicePen AI have a mobile app?
The data does not mention native mobile apps; it likely works via web upload.
What happens to unused Splice credits?
Unused credits roll over, but capped at a maximum of 200 unused credits.
Can I use Splice samples in commercial projects?
Yes, all Splice samples are royalty-free, so you can use them in commercial music.
Does VoicePen AI support real-time transcription?
The data does not indicate real-time transcription; it uses file uploads or URLs.
